begin process at 2010 02 10 09:32:34
  Trouver un code source :
 
dans
 
Accueil > Forum > 

Archive Java

 > 

Archives

 > 

JDBC

 > 

Problème de select sur une date (DATETIME....) et problème d'Update...


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Problème de select sur une date (DATETIME....) et problème d'Update...

lundi 16 mai 2005 à 10:40:06 | Problème de select sur une date (DATETIME....) et problème d'Update...

zeldoi5

Membre Club

Bonjour tout le monde, j'explique mon problème :
J'ai deux tables :

Table Mesure :
Id_mesure | Id_sonde | Date | Heure | Date_heure

Table Performances :
Id_mesure  | Mesure_cpu  | Mesure_ram  | Size_ram  | Mesure_process  | Mesure_  Size_hdd 

Je voudrai faire un Update sur la table Performances pour insérer la valeur Mesure_cpu selon une condition bien particulière : en fonction de la date de la mesure effectuée (date qui se trouve dans la table Mesure...)

Ne sachant pas si on peut faire un Update avec une jointure à l'intérieur
J'ai décidé de faire un Select, de récupérer le résultat et de le mettre dans mon Update (je code en Java sur une base de données MySQL...)

Je vous marque donc les requêtes :
String RechercheId="SELECT Id_mesure FROM mesure WHERE Date like "+Date12+" and Heure like "+Date22+" ";

avec Date12 et Date22 les dates contenues dans les champs Date et Heure, Date12 = 2005-04-17 et Date22 = 14:24:16

String InsertCPU="UPDATE performances p SET p.Mesure_cpu="+valueCPU2+" WHERE Id_mesure="+IdTrouve+"";

J'ai un message d'erreur sur la recherche de l'heure...
Message SQLException: You have an error in your SQL syntax.  Check the manual that corresponds to your MySQL server version for the right syntax to use near ':24:16' at line 1

J'ai essayé de faire une recherche sur le champs Date_heure qui est au format 0000-00-00 00:00:00, mais ça me fait l'erreur suivante

Message SQLException: You have an error in your SQL syntax.  Check the manual that corresponds to your MySQL server version for the right syntax to use near '14:24:16' at line 1
...

Je comprends pas.... Qui plus est sur phpMyAdmin (ce que j'utilise pour administrer ma bas les requêtes passent...)

lundi 16 mai 2005 à 12:08:05 | Re : Problème de select sur une date (DATETIME....) et problème d'Update...

jef_b

Réponse acceptée !
Hi !

Je ne sais pas si c'est lié à ça, mais est-ce que tu essayé avec des ' pour encadrer les dates et les heures ?

@+
Jef.
lundi 16 mai 2005 à 13:46:47 | Re : Problème de select sur une date (DATETIME....) et problème d'Update...

zeldoi5

Membre Club
Oui! C'est ça!

Pour faire une recherche sur la date, aps besoin de " ou de ', mais pour une recherche sur un champs de type Time il faut obligatoirement des '.
Encore fallait il le trouver....

Merci beaucoup!!!!!


Cette discussion est classée dans : problème, date, id, mesure, update


Répondre à ce message

Sujets en rapport avec ce message

Date : contrôle de cohérence [ par jogsx ] Bonjour à tous et toutes.Je suis débutant en JAVA et j'ai un petit problème pour manipuler les dates.Mon problème est le suivant : j'utilise une varia Création d'un paint en java... [ par ralkif ] Slt !Bon voila mon problème...voila l'intitulé de ma classe principale :class Dessin extends JFrame implements MouseListener, MouseMotionListenerje dé problème:Scrollable ResultSet [ par abdesa1 ] Bonjour à tous,voilà j'ai un problème pour accéder à la dernière ligne de ma table: c'est pour afficher le id suivant dans la JTextField??? merci pour problème SQL .. [ par kokojavafr ] Bonjour tout le monde, je poste ici car je commence m'enerver sur mon code .. Bon , voici la table qui sera incriminée : TABLE fichenaissance (     probleme executeQuery [ par elfourbos ] Bonjour a tous trés cher amis développeurvoila bien comme d'habitude j'arrive avec un problème mais j'ai pu apporter des solutions a d'autres problème manipulation des date [ par asouma ] j ai un problème dans la manipulation de format de date.Je travaille avec une BD mysql dans laquelle la format de date par défaut est 0000-00-00 00:00 Debutant Stuts [ par Booster ] Bonsoir à tous, Voila j'ai un petit souci avec les struts en gros pour vite résumer je veux passer des parramétre d'une classe vers une jsp ... et je Problème installation java version 6 update 11 [ par newland ] Bonjour,J'ai voulu faire une mise à jour de java passage update 11, une fois installé il me détecte toujours la version 6.0.Avec mozilla et IE c'est l Problème java / hibernate [ par frimmmm ] Bonjour tout le monde ! merci a ceux qui me liront :p Voila je vous explique mon problème : Je suis entrain de faire un programme en java ( swt ) uti java.sql.date [ par zenglena9 ] bonjour, j'utilise la classe java.sql.date pour la saisie d'une date.mon problème est que je voudrais contrôler la saisie de manière à ce qu'un utilis


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Février 2010
LMMJVSD
1234567
891011121314
15161718192021
22232425262728

Consulter la suite du CalendriCode

 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,374 sec (4)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ales